A health ministry report claims that Uganda has run out of most antiretroviral (ARV) medications, HIV testing kits, meds for opportunistic infections and critical diagnostic tools for HIV care, IRIN reports. The ministry claims that requests for assistance had been sent to the U.S. President’s Emergency Plan for AIDS Relief (PEPFAR) and the Global Fund to Fight AIDS, Tuberculosis and Malaria. It appears demand is outpacing supply.
